If etiquette holds true, and each moms resolve that they wish to coordinate their outfits, the mother of the bride ought to select her color first. She then tells the mother of the groom the color/outfit alternative, and the grooms mother can then select a dress of similar formality in a color that doesn’t conflict. Choosing the gown you wear on your daughter or son’s marriage ceremony must be a considerate process. You will wish to contemplate style for the formality of the event, the season, location, and any color specs made by the couple.
